Location interface
Uma região na qual a conta de banco de dados do Azure Cosmos DB é implantada.
Propriedades
| document |
O ponto de extremidade de conexão para a região específica. Exemplo: https://<accountName>–<locationName>.documents.azure.com:443/ O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or. |
| failover |
A prioridade de failover da região. Uma prioridade de failover de 0 indica uma região de gravação. O valor máximo para uma prioridade de failover = (número total de regiões – 1). Os valores de prioridade de failover devem ser exclusivos para cada uma das regiões nas quais a conta de banco de dados existe. |
| id | O identificador exclusivo da região dentro da conta de banco de dados. Exemplo: <accountName>–<locationName>.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or. |
| is |
Sinalizador para indicar se essa região é ou não uma região de AvailabilityZone |
| location |
O nome da região. |
| provisioning |
O status da conta do Cosmos DB no momento em que a operação foi chamada. O status pode ser um dos seguintes. 'Criando' – a conta do Cosmos DB está sendo criada. Quando uma conta está em Criando estado, somente as propriedades especificadas como entrada para a operação de conta Criar Cosmos DB são retornadas. 'Êxito' – a conta do Cosmos DB está ativa para uso. 'Atualizando' – a conta do Cosmos DB está sendo atualizada. 'Excluindo' – a conta do Cosmos DB está sendo excluída. 'Falha' – falha na criação da conta do Cosmos DB. 'DeletionFailed' – falha na exclusão da conta do Cosmos DB.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or. |
Detalhes da propriedade
documentEndpoint
O ponto de extremidade de conexão para a região específica. Exemplo: https://<accountName>–<locationName>.documents.azure.com:443/ O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.
documentEndpoint?: string
Valor da propriedade
string
failoverPriority
A prioridade de failover da região. Uma prioridade de failover de 0 indica uma região de gravação. O valor máximo para uma prioridade de failover = (número total de regiões – 1). Os valores de prioridade de failover devem ser exclusivos para cada uma das regiões nas quais a conta de banco de dados existe.
failoverPriority?: number
Valor da propriedade
number
id
O identificador exclusivo da região dentro da conta de banco de dados. Exemplo: <accountName>–<locationName>.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.
id?: string
Valor da propriedade
string
isZoneRedundant
Sinalizador para indicar se essa região é ou não uma região de AvailabilityZone
isZoneRedundant?: boolean
Valor da propriedade
boolean
locationName
O nome da região.
locationName?: string
Valor da propriedade
string
provisioningState
O status da conta do Cosmos DB no momento em que a operação foi chamada. O status pode ser um dos seguintes. 'Criando' – a conta do Cosmos DB está sendo criada. Quando uma conta está em Criando estado, somente as propriedades especificadas como entrada para a operação de conta Criar Cosmos DB são retornadas. 'Êxito' – a conta do Cosmos DB está ativa para uso. 'Atualizando' – a conta do Cosmos DB está sendo atualizada. 'Excluindo' – a conta do Cosmos DB está sendo excluída. 'Falha' – falha na criação da conta do Cosmos DB. 'DeletionFailed' – falha na exclusão da conta do Cosmos DB.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.
provisioningState?: string
Valor da propriedade
string